Output 70e31b06c44368ee42969b209956dcc25bbfb5d68d99648d77cf7ff5d9f78ab4:59

value
24338
script pubkey
OP_0 OP_PUSHBYTES_20 163cd80809d1be1080d921fab951a88d64602430
address
bc1qzc7dszqf6xlppqxey8atj5dg34jxqfpshdmu6p
transaction
70e31b06c44368ee42969b209956dcc25bbfb5d68d99648d77cf7ff5d9f78ab4
spent
true